You can get regular counselling. It really helps. Basically it helps to write down what upset you. Then see why it upset you. Then write what you did. Now finally write what else you could have done and said in that situation. If you do that regularly u will see a change in yourself. Plus meet friends. Talk to people . Exercise daily. Pressure is a part of life. Learning to respond calmly will help you in the long run too. Identify triggers and practice taking deep breaths daily and do that under times of stress. Keep calm down phrases ready like " I can get thru this, it's okay" " It's not their fault. They are under pressure too. Stay calm and respond. People can have different views" etc. It is a skill we learn just like learning how to improve our handwriting etc.
